Retina Vitreous Associates is looking for a Transcriptionist/Scribe to join our growing team! The Transcription team members at Retina Vitreous Associates are responsible and accountable for efficiently and accurately completing the Electronic Health Record (EHR) for all exams, testing interpretations, referrals, notes, etc. The Transcription team members work effectively with Physicians and other team members to ensure quality documentation in the patients’ health records.

Responsibilities:

Efficient and accurate data entry in the EHR system based on Physician dictation.

Great attention to detail and ability to recognize inconsistencies and missing necessary data.

Ability to work independently.

Effectively communicate with the Physicians, Executive Director, and other team members.
